Output 641a677eff6b603772f71ac4b12cef8d94864e9d9c51251455c204af90550a78:17

value
17100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4865ccc4fed0d6e2ef55d162e02474234f9c9d0 OP_EQUALVERIFY OP_CHECKSIG
address
1HTXbCYrRFJzxmT1yj1qdeU1iU6HJi5SLL
transaction
641a677eff6b603772f71ac4b12cef8d94864e9d9c51251455c204af90550a78
confirmations
528660
spent
true